Your Impact
-
Architect Distributed Services: Design and build large-scale distributed services for telemetry ingestion, event streaming, and command orchestration across both edge and cloud environments.
-
Deliver Real-Time Data: Implement real-time data pipelines using Kafka, NATS, or gRPC streams to ensure low-latency, high-throughput processing.
-
Manage Stateful Systems: Maintain and optimize stateful services like Redis, InfluxDB, and Postgres for consistency, replication, and failover in multi-region deployments.
-
Automate Infrastructure: Develop infrastructure-as-code (Terraform, Helm) and CI/CD workflows to automate testing, security scans, and rolling upgrades.
-
Champion Reliability: Monitor and troubleshoot production systems with Prometheus, Grafana, Jaeger, and other observability tools to meet ambitious 99.99% uptime goals. Champion best practices in reliability engineering, capacity planning, and incident response.
-
Collaborate Cross-Functionally: Work with embedded, controls, and ML teams to define API contracts, message schemas (Protobuf), and service SLAs.
What You'll Bring
-
Experience: 5+ years building and operating distributed, fault-tolerant systems in production.
-
Foundational Knowledge: A deep understanding of distributed systems concepts, including consensus (Raft/Paxos), partition tolerance, consistency models, and backpressure.
-
Technical Expertise:
-
Hands-on experience with streaming platforms (Kafka, Pulsar) or message queues (NATS, RabbitMQ).
-
Proficiency in systems programming (C++/Go/Python) with a strong grasp of CS fundamentals (algorithms, data structures, networking).
-
Expertise in container orchestration (Kubernetes), service mesh (Istio/Linkerd), and microservices architecture.
-
Solid background with observability stacks (Prometheus/Grafana, OpenTelemetry, Jaeger/Zipkin).
-
-
Automation: A track record of automating infrastructure (Terraform, Ansible) and building reliable CI/CD pipelines.
-
Soft Skills: Excellent communication skills, a collaborative mindset, and a bias for pragmatic solutions.